Purpose and Benefits of the Project Manager Job Description
The Project Manager Job Description form is significant for several reasons. First, it establishes clear expectations for job roles, which is crucial for maintaining productivity within teams. Second, it reduces misunderstandings regarding project manager responsibilities, ensuring that all parties are aware of their obligations.
Additionally, this documentation supports compliance with employment regulations, further protecting both employers and employees. By using an employee job description form, organizations can create a transparent work environment that enhances communication and accountability.

Who needs to sign the Project Manager Job Description?
The employee designated as the Project Manager must sign the form to acknowledge their agreement with the described duties and responsibilities outlined within the document.
Is there a time limit for submitting the Project Manager Job Description?
While there is typically no strict time limit for submitting a job description, it is best practice to complete and sign the form before the start of a new role or position assignment.
